逻辑模块是指计算机系统中负责处理逻辑运算的部分,通常包含了逻辑单元和控制单元。它是计算机运行的核心部件之一,负责处理输入的数据,进行各种运算,生成输出结果。逻辑模块广泛应用于计算机、通信和嵌入式等领域,是各种数字电子产品的核心部分。
逻辑模块的主要作用是进行逻辑运算。逻辑运算是指根据一组输入信号,利用逻辑门电路来进行逻辑运算,比如“与”、“或”和“非”等运算。逻辑模块可以将这些逻辑运算组合在一起,构建出复杂的逻辑电路,实现复杂的功能。同时,逻辑模块还可以进行算术运算、比较运算、移位运算等,实现更复杂的功能。
逻辑模块的另一个重要作用是控制。逻辑模块通过控制单元来控制整个系统的运行,包括时序控制、状态控制和数据控制等。控制单元负责从存储器中读取指令,解码指令,执行指令,并根据指令的结果更新状态。逻辑模块在控制网络中起到关键作用,它可以通过确定各个信号的时序和状态来控制整个系统的运行。
逻辑模块广泛应用于计算机、通信和嵌入式等领域。在计算机中,逻辑模块主要用于CPU中,进行运算和控制。在通信领域,逻辑模块被用于各种通信设备中,如路由器、交换机、调制解调器等。逻辑模块在这些设备中起到了关键作用,它们可以处理海量的数据流,实现高速数据传输和复杂网络控制。在嵌入式领域,逻辑模块被广泛应用于各种智能化设备中,如智能家居、智能手环、智能马桶等。
逻辑模块的设计需要考虑多个方面,包括逻辑单元、控制单元、时序控制和状态控制等。逻辑单元是逻辑模块的核心部分,负责进行逻辑运算。控制单元负责控制逻辑模块的运行,包括指令解码、状态更新等。时序控制是指控制各个信号的时序,保证系统的同步和性能。状态控制是指控制系统的状态转移,如切换各个模式、状态的转移等。
逻辑模块的设计需要考虑多种因素,如功耗、面积、速度和可靠性等。逻辑模块的设计者需要在这些因素之间权衡,寻找最优的设计方案。同时,逻辑模块的设计还需要考虑各种技术和工具的应用,如EDA工具、器件库等。